11 USB devices Using a USB device Universal Serial Bus (USB) is a hardware interface that can be used to connect an optional external device, such as a USB keyboard, mouse, drive, printer, scanner, or hub. Devices can be connected to the system, an optional docking device, or an optional expansion product. Some USB devices may require additional support software, which is usually included with the device. For more information about device-specific software, refer to the manufacturer's instructions. The device has 2 USB ports, which support USB 1.0, USB 1.1, and USB 2.0 devices. Depending on the model, the device may also have a HP Mini Mobile Drive Bay, which supports an optional HP Mini Mobile Drive. An optional USB hub, optional docking device, or an optional expansion product provides additional USB ports that can be used with the device. Connecting a USB device CAUTION: To prevent damage to a USB connector, use minimal force to connect a USB device. ▲ To connect a USB device, connect the USB cable for the device to the USB port. NOTE: When the USB device is detected, the file manager opens and displays the content of the device. Removing a USB device CAUTION: To prevent loss of information or an unresponsive system, do not remove a USB device while it is being accessed. Using a USB device 61
